The blended coal is charged into a number of slot type ovens wherein each oven shares a common heating flue with the adjacent oven. Coal is carbonized in a reducing atmosphere and the off-gas is collected and sent to the by-product plant where various by-products are recovered. Hence, this process is called by-product cokemaking.
This is known as the caking process. The quality of the resultant coke is determined by the qualities of the coking coals used, as well as the coke plant operating conditions. Coke quality is largely influenced by coal rank, composition, mineral content and the ability to soften when heated, become plastic, and resolidify into a coherent mass.

Coal may be used without any processing other than crushing and screening to reduce the fragments to a useable and consistent size. However, black coal is often washed to remove pieces of rock or mineral that may be present. This also reduces ash and improves overall quality.

Coal occurs in four main types or ranks: Lignite or brown coal, bituminous or black coal, anthracite and graphite. These ranks are a result of the geological process that has occurred over time, and they have different physical and chemical properties which can be verified by proper testing techniques.
